Star Noodle Menu
Noodles
All Ramen, Saimin, Fried Soup, Look Funn, and Udon Noodles Made In-House Daily!
Dish | Description | Price |
Hot ‘n Sour | Chili Lime Dashi, Smoked Prosciutto, Shrimp, Cilantro, Thai Basil, Bean Sprouts, Fried Garlic | $20 |
Hapa Ramen | Rich Pork Broth, Roasted Pork Belly, Soft Boiled Egg, Kamaboko, Bamboo Shoots, Mayu | $21 |
Local Saimin | Wafu Dashi Broth, Spam, Kamaboko, Egg, Scallions | $17 |
Star Udon | Rich Pork Broth, Roasted Pork Belly, Scallions | $17 |
Kim Chee Ramen | Chicken and Shiitake Broth, Egg Strips, House Kim Chee, Roasted Pork | $20 |
Garlic Noodles | Fresh & Fried Garlic, Dashi, Scallions | $18 |
Lahaina Fried Soup | Fat Chow Funn, Pork, Bean Sprouts, Sesame | $19 |
Look Moore Funn | Rice Noodle, Scallops, Shrimp, Black Bean Sauce | $21 |
Pad Thai | Rice Noodle, Chicken, Shrimp, Egg, Peanuts, Chives | $19 |
Singapore Noodles | Vermicelli, Chicken, Shrimp, Egg, Cilantro, Curry | $19 |

Top 5 Recommended Must-Try Dishes at Star Noodle Maui Menu (From Local Reviews)
From my own visits and research into diner favorites, these five dishes consistently stood out as must-tries:
1. Garlic Noodles
These are Star Noodle’s signature. The combination of butter, garlic, and scallions creates a comforting, crave-worthy dish. Not too greasy, just balanced.

2. Pork Buns
Soft steamed buns filled with juicy pork belly. They’re tender, sweet, and salty all at once.
3. Vietnamese Crepe
Crispy, savory, and packed with shrimp, pork, and bean sprouts. Served with fresh herbs and dipping sauce.

4. Hapa Ramen
A hearty bowl with a rich broth, noodles, egg, and pork. Perfect for those craving something warm and satisfying.

5. Ahi Avo
Fresh ahi tuna tossed with avocado, lemon, and seasonings. A fresh and flavorful starter.

Each dish showcases the chef’s attention to balance, flavor, and presentation.
